What are some common challenges faced by professionals working on DARPA projects in a remote capacity?
Working remotely on DARPA projects often involves navigating strict security protocols, which can limit access to sensitive data and require specialized secure communication tools. Collaboration across multiple time zones and organizations is common, necessitating strong coordination and self-management skills. Additionally, remote team members must stay proactive in maintaining alignment with project milestones and adapting to rapidly evolving research objectives. Despite these challenges, the role offers unique opportunities to contribute to cutting-edge advancements while enjoying the flexibility of remote work.
What is a remote DARPA job?
A remote DARPA job refers to a position with the Defense Advanced Research Projects Agency (DARPA) that allows employees to work from locations outside the traditional office setting, often from home or another remote location. DARPA is a U.S. government agency responsible for developing emerging technologies for national security. Remote roles may include research, project management, technical writing, or administrative tasks, depending on the project and security requirements. These positions may require specialized skills and often involve working on innovative, cutting-edge projects. Security clearance and U.S. citizenship are typically required for most DARPA jobs.
